A star is usually said to be born when atoms of lighter elements are subjected to high compression under the influence of high pressure and temperature condition and also due to the gravitational collapsing of interstellar particles, that allow the nucleus of the atom to undergo the process of fusion. This leads to the release of a significantly large amount of energy in all directions.
In simple words, these stars result from the gravitational collapsing of the clouds of interstellar particles such as gases and dust particles.
The luminosity of a star depends on the amount of hydrogen gas it contains, which undergoes fusion by nuclear reaction process.
